Output 43c91ed9fb553072088f9d72fbca4ee2c70ecbe803b96092bcdf42cfc57df2e2:1

value
31760
script pubkey
OP_0 OP_PUSHBYTES_20 da142a45915ae66f889902251ee114ef237faedd
address
bc1qmg2z53v3ttnxlzyeqgj3acg5au3hltkam7r7cm
transaction
43c91ed9fb553072088f9d72fbca4ee2c70ecbe803b96092bcdf42cfc57df2e2
confirmations
20937
spent
true